Hue to build railway overpass to reduce congestion at northern gateway

Hue City to construct railway overpass at ring road 3 and national highway 1A junction to ease northern gateway congestion.

On 9/5, the Hue City Project Management Board for Investment and Construction of Transport Works announced an adjusted total investment for the Ring Road 3 project, increasing from 750 billion VND to over 1,600 billion VND for phases 2 and 3. This increase primarily funds the construction of a North-South railway overpass at the junction of National Highway 1A and Nguyen Van Linh Road in Huong An ward.

The overpass, designed with four lanes and eight beam spans, will stretch over 292 meters in length and 17.5 meters in width. This structure is a key component of the 6.5-kilometer Ring Road 3, connecting National Highway 1A with National Highway 49A. Its starting point on Nguyen Van Linh Road will traverse the North-South railway and National Highway 1A, linking to the northern segment of Ring Road 3.

The Project Management Board highlighted the intersection's current high traffic density, attributed to its proximity to the Northern Bus Station and its role as a key gateway to central Hue City. With Ring Road 3's completion, traffic volume is projected to rise sharply. Without the railway overpass, the area faces a significant risk of congestion and safety hazards.

A representative from the Project Management Board stated, "Ring Road 3 is poised to become a vital traffic artery, redirecting volume from National Highway 1A, which currently traverses the city center. This overpass will significantly reduce congestion and enhance traffic safety at the junction."

The Ring Road 3 project traverses Huong An, Kim Long, and Thuy Xuan wards, connecting National Highway 1A with National Highway 49A. Phase 1 successfully completed Nguyen Hoang Bridge over the Perfume River, an investment exceeding 1,550 billion VND. Currently, work is underway on expanding Nguyen Hoang Road and constructing An Ninh Ha Bridge across the Bach Yen River.

Phase 2, approximately 2.25 kilometers long, will connect Nguyen Van Linh Road to Ly Nam De Road and include the construction of three reinforced concrete bridges over canals.

Phase 3, extending about 3.6 kilometers, will link the Perfume River overpass area on Bui Thi Xuan Road to National Highway 49A on Vo Van Kiet Road. The complete Ring Road 3 will feature a 43-meter-wide cross-section, incorporating integrated lighting, landscaping, and sidewalks.
